Return on Equity measures how efficiently a company uses shareholders' equity to generate profits. A higher ROE indicates better profitability relative to equity.

180 Degree Capital (TURN) FAQ

As of the most recent data, TURN shows a ROE of 0.83%. That is below the Finance sector average of 16.71%. Scroll down for historical charts and peer comparison views.

The Finance sector average ROE is about 16.71%. 180 Degree Capital is at 0.83%, which is lower that average. That is roughly 95.1% below the sector mean. Use the comparison chart on this page to see how TURN stacks up against individual peers as well.
